Spoke to someone at phillip island motor sports today regarding the future of the trackside campground.

Some of you may have noticed in the latest issue of AMCN that the proposed redevelopment of the phillip island GP circuit and surrounding environs includes a go kart track, a720m replica of the main circuit :shock: :lol:

anyway according to the plans its right smack bang in the middle of my residence for 3 1/2 days per year :x

with the (go kart) track programmed to be complete by christmas 2005 - yes about 4 weeks away - i was pleased to hear that the "trackside" campground will be operational for the wsb come march. the camping will continue in its current location with the (go kart) track used as part of the access road.

after spending the entire time this year reminding some of the - cough - more virginal pilgrims - about traditions i was concerned that our tradition of camping at the island would be taken away, i'll sleep easier tonight knowing all shoudl be well.

Fans who choose to stay in the Trackside Campground are in for a big surprise at the forthcoming 2006 Yamaha Superbike World Championship event at Phillip Island from March 3-5.

The trackside campground layout and facilities have been revamped and part of that development has seen a Mini Grand Prix Circuit constructed which is 740 metres long and is essentially a scaled down replica of the main track layout. This will operate as a go-kart circuit when major events are not taking place on the main track.

The improvement to the campground that will be available for patrons in March include:

A significant increase in size to compensate for the space lost to the bitumen surface. The eastern and southern perimeter fences of the campground have been moved closer to Doohan Corner and Southern Loop with some great new vantage points.

A campground extension has been made into the large area of trees near the entrance and this area will be reserved for volunteer officials as well as a quiet area for campers who want to be a little further away from the revelry

A special area on the western boundary has been allocated for the Superbike event patrons with Campervans, Caravans or camper trailers. The rest of the campground with spectacular views across the circuit will be reserved exclusively for patrons who arrive on a motorcycle

Each area will now be provided with it's own dedicated toilet block

The new pit building adjacent to the campground entertainment area will be utilised as a the campground managers information area and first aid station.

Access to the campground ill open from 0900 on Thursday March 2nd and will remain open until Monday March 6th at 1200. Bands will play on Friday, Saturday and Sunday night in the entertainment area.
